Saddleback College is located in Mission Viejo, CA.

During the most recent reporting year, 11 computer software applications degrees were awarded at Saddleback College.

Online Class Availability at Saddleback College

Distance learning is available at Saddleback College. Of 20,764 students, 10,784 (52%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 5,942 (29%) took at least some classes online.
